Discover the insightful analysis of post-war economics in Economic Problems of Peace after War: Volume 1, The W. Stanley Jevons Lectures at University College, London, in 1917 by William Robert Scott. Originally published in 1917, this compelling work delves into the intricate relationship between economics and the quest for peace following the First World War. Scott's lectures, delivered at University College, London, provide a thorough examination of the economic conditions necessary for the cessation of warfare and the challenges of reparations.
